Output 510346d6c100a1fa7ea452ac66b95e01f6e2277cfb1d047c1f99cef1993cafa3:0

value
77900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e34963ea3bb4b626d82c1d75bd13239fa12c7704 OP_EQUAL
address
MUcwYDsCsuQnYvfwpuP4vqbpcq5KWuCWyL
transaction
510346d6c100a1fa7ea452ac66b95e01f6e2277cfb1d047c1f99cef1993cafa3
spent
true